This is a description of a medication that contains Ibuprofen (800 mg) and Famotidine (26.6 mg) in a film-coated tablet form. The tablets are distributed by Aurobindo Pharma USA, Inc. The dosage and administration instructions can be found in the package insert provided with the medication. It is manufactured in India and should be stored at 20° to 25°C (68° to 77°F). Each tablet comes with a Medication Guide for patients. The packaging of the medication includes a GTIN, Serial Number, Expiry Date, and LOT for identification purposes. Pharmacies are instructed to dispense the medication with the accompanying Medication Guide.*
